L7 Bassist Jennifer Finch Battles Brain Cancer: How You Can Help (2026)

The music industry is in a state of shock and solidarity as news breaks about Jennifer Finch, the iconic bassist of '90s grunge pioneers L7. Finch has been diagnosed with brain cancer, a devastating development that has prompted her bandmates and the wider music community to rally around her.

A Grunge Legend's Battle

Finch's journey with L7 spans decades, and her influence on the grunge scene is undeniable. The band's comeback in 2019 with 'Scatter the Rats' after a 20-year hiatus was a testament to their enduring spirit and relevance. However, unforeseen health complications have now led to multiple surgeries, resulting in physical limitations for Finch.

A Community's Response

In a heartfelt statement, L7's singer and guitarist Donita Sparks expressed the band's collective devastation and their unwavering support for Finch. The setup of a GoFundMe page reflects the music industry's unity and willingness to help one of its own. Sparks' words, "Jennifer is family," resonate deeply, emphasizing the tight-knit nature of the music community and their commitment to supporting artists in times of need.

The Impact of Loss and Resilience

While Finch's absence from L7's upcoming North American tour is a significant loss for fans, her encouragement to the band to continue without her speaks volumes about her resilience and the enduring spirit of the group.
